curat  

s.

1eccl.occupationpriest having cure of souls
( 1393-94 )  […] si qe par defaut de tielx curates […] les parochiens ne soient periz pur defaute de bone doctrine  iii 321
( a.1399; MS: a.1399 )  toutz autres curates eauntz benefices de seint esglise  128.30
